The Misconception: Measuring in Milligrams

Asking for the caffeine content in 1mg of matcha is like asking for the mileage of one drop of gasoline; it's a unit too small to be meaningful in a practical sense. Matcha is not dosed in milligrams, but in grams, with a typical serving ranging from 1 to 4 grams, depending on the preparation style and desired strength. The average caffeine content is between 19 and 44 milligrams per gram of matcha powder. Therefore, 1mg of matcha powder would contain a minuscule and almost undetectable amount of caffeine, likely less than half a milligram. The more relevant and useful measurement is the amount of caffeine per standard serving, which varies widely.

Factors Influencing Matcha's Caffeine Levels

Several variables determine the final caffeine content of your matcha drink. These are not constant across all products and preparations, which is why a range of values is always provided.

Growing and Harvesting

  • Grade and Quality: The most significant factor is the grade of matcha. Ceremonial grade, made from the youngest tea leaves, typically contains more caffeine than culinary grade, which uses more mature leaves. This is because younger leaves have higher concentrations of caffeine and L-theanine.
  • Shading: Matcha tea plants are shaded for several weeks before harvest. This process boosts the chlorophyll and amino acid content, including L-theanine, and also increases the concentration of caffeine in the leaves.
  • Harvest Time: The 'first flush' or first harvest of the year generally yields leaves with the highest caffeine content compared to subsequent harvests.

Preparation Method

  • Amount of Powder: The more matcha powder you use, the higher the total caffeine content in your drink will be. A traditional thin tea (usucha) may use less powder than a thick tea (koicha) or a latte.
  • Water Temperature: Brewing matcha with hotter water extracts more caffeine (and other compounds) from the powder. Using slightly cooler water can result in a less caffeinated beverage.

How Matcha's Caffeine Works: The L-Theanine Effect

One of the most notable differences between the energy boost from matcha and coffee is the presence of L-theanine in matcha. This amino acid is known to promote relaxation and help induce a state of calm alertness, working synergistically with caffeine to provide a smoother, more sustained energy lift.

Unlike coffee's fast absorption, which can cause jitters and a sudden crash, matcha's caffeine is absorbed more slowly. The combination of caffeine and L-theanine results in a focused, steady energy that can last for several hours without the negative side effects often associated with coffee. For those sensitive to caffeine, this can be a game-changer, offering the energy without the anxiety.

Comparative Caffeine Content: Matcha, Coffee, and Tea

To put matcha's caffeine content into perspective, here is a comparison based on typical serving sizes.

Beverage Caffeine Content per Gram (approx.) Caffeine Content per Serving (approx.)
Matcha 19–44 mg/g 40–180 mg (2-4g serving)
Brewed Coffee 10–12 mg/g 80–100 mg (8 oz cup)
Black Tea 14–35 mg/g 64–112 mg (8 oz cup)
Regular Green Tea 11–25 mg/g 30–40 mg (8 oz cup)

Tips for Enjoying Matcha Mindfully

For those who are sensitive to caffeine or just want to manage their intake, here are a few tips:

  • Start with less powder: A good starting point is a smaller serving (e.g., 1 gram) to gauge your tolerance. You can always increase the amount later.
  • Use cooler water: A lower water temperature during whisking will extract less caffeine and result in a milder brew.
  • Choose culinary grade: If you consistently prefer a lower-caffeine option, opt for culinary-grade matcha, which is made from older leaves with naturally less caffeine.
  • Mix with milk: Creating a matcha latte with milk or a milk alternative can help to dilute the concentration of caffeine per sip.
  • Time your intake: Avoid consuming matcha late in the day to prevent it from interfering with your sleep schedule.

Beyond Caffeine: The Whole-Leaf Benefit

Drinking matcha means consuming the entire tea leaf, ground into a fine powder. This differs significantly from steeped teas, where the leaves are discarded. This whole-leaf consumption is why matcha provides a more concentrated dose of nutrients, including antioxidants and fiber. The health benefits extend beyond just energy, contributing to overall well-being. This complete consumption is also what contributes to its higher caffeine content compared to regular green tea.
